Методологии разработки

В наши дни наиболее затребованными на мировом рынке являются такие характеристики, как комплексность и скорость. В подобной среде при управлении проектами целесообразно руководствоваться следующим правилом: сделай это, сделай это правильно, сделай это правильно прямо сейчас. Учитывая это обстоятельство, ProgressSoft для удовлетворения требований клиентов и построения с ними взаимовыгодных длительных отношений уделяет особое внимание применению передовых методологий управления проектами.

Скрам-проекты

Группа наших специалистов выбрала наиболее подходящий метод, согласующийся со стратегическими задачами проекта: Скрам-проекты (от англ. scrum – «схватка»). Это гибкий, так называемый agile-подход к управлению проектами, в основе которого лежит итеративная инкрементная структура управления проектами. С его помощью выстраивается мастер-проект, позволяющий разрабатывать и предоставлять конечному пользователю заявленную систему, соответствующую согласованным требованиям.

По своей сути Скрам – это очень простой процесс, разбитый на итерации (прим. – ограниченные по времени шаги разработки, нацеленные на создание отдельных возможностей) и обеспечивающий выполнение изначально поставленных задач на момент завершения каждого скрам-периода. Это один из наиболее эффективных и гибких подходов к разработке программного обеспечения, создающий ряд преимуществ, в том числе повышение качества продукта на выходе, сокращение затрачиваемого на его разработку времени, достижение ожидаемых результатов по мере приращения функционала в ходе реализации процесса. Данный подход позволяет оперативно реализовывать изменения в соответствии с отзывами клиентов, при этом совершенствуя продукт на каждом последующем этапе его разработки.

Экстремальное программирование

Группа наших экспертов также применяет инженерные практики экстремального программирования, которые составляют метод разработки программного обеспечения. Отличительными особенностями данного метода являются простота, постоянная обратная связь, смелость и взаимодействие. Главным преимуществом экстремального программирования является возможность оценивать, правильно ли продвигается разработка продукта, после каждого маленького шага в ходе процесса, будь то планирование, кодирование или тестирование, и вносить изменения без перерасхода средств.

При разработке методом экстремального программирования клиент становится частью команды ProgressSoft и мы вместе создаем успешный проект. Клиент вовлечен в разработку продукта на всех этапах этого процесса благодаря регулярному, надежному и оперативному взаимодействию, что позволяет ему четко сообщать нам напрямую о своих бизнес-предпочтениях, сохранять уверенность, устранять недопонимание и быстрее получать желаемые результаты. В течение всего проекта клиент может давать проектной группе мгновенную обратную связь. Это не только значительно ускоряет процесс добавления новых желаемых функций, но и дает клиенту возможность направлять реализацию проекта таким образом, чтобы создавать дополнительную ценность.

Совместная разработка

ProgressSoft стремится устанавливать с нашими клиентами партнерские отношения для того, чтобы достижение стратегических проектных целей происходило с минимальными затратами и при этом максимально эффективно. Клиенты компании ProgressSoft не только наши «пассивные потребители», но и «активные участники», вовлеченные во все этапы разработки и внедрения продукта. Они – ключевой компонент совместного создания успешного, легкого в управлении и устойчивого программного обеспечения.

Мы сопровождаем наших клиентов даже после поставки продуктов, предоставляя им, помимо послепродажного и сервисного обслуживания, также полную поддержку, что придает им уверенность при осуществлении бизнес планов.

Другие профессиональные услуги:

Консультационные услуги

Консультационные услуги

Предоставление широкому кругу клиентов ряда услуг независимых консультантов в сфере ИКТ, информационных технологий и коммерческой деятельности.
Читать далее

Корпоративное развертывание ПО

Корпоративное развертывание ПО

Тщательное планирование внедрения решений путем выявления точных требований к установке именно в вашей организации.
Читать далее

Интеграция

Интеграция

Совместимость систем играет исключительно важную роль в деятельности любой организации.
Читать далее

Услуги по обучению

Услуги по обучению

В достижении долговременного успеха при работе в среде нового программного решения ключевую роль играют знания.
Читать далее